In 1830, in a Normandy village called Villedieu-les-Poles, Mr. Ernest Mauviel established the Mauviel manufacturing company. Since the very early years, Mauviel has been a fixture in the professional and commercial markets. Mauviel continues to offer the professional chef, products that are unsurpassed in quality and design. These same products are now also available to household markets.
A Saucepan is a deep cooking vessel with a handle and sometimes a lid; used for boiling, stewing and making sauces. The saucepan can range in sizes to hold contents for one pint or in sizes up to four quarts.
